Top Android Utilities for Protection- Mindful Individuals
For those who prioritize digital security , several excellent Android apps offer enhanced features. Signal is a must-have for secure messaging, providing end-to-end security. Orbot/Orfox provides robust proxying capabilities to mask your IP address and enhance anonymity . Nextcloud gives you a personal, self-hosted cloud storage solution that puts your data back in the hands. Lastly, Blokada is a fantastic ad blocker and tracker blocker which protects against unwanted surveillance while browsing.

Artificial Intelligence and Your Information: Assessing the Security of Popular Android Apps
The rise of intelligent applications on Android devices presents a increasing concern regarding user data security. Many seemingly harmless utilities leverage AI to personalize experiences, but this often involves collecting and processing vast amounts of personal information. It's vital for users to carefully review app permissions—bestowing access to contacts, location, or even microphone info can pose a risk if these applications aren’t adequately secured. Developers have a responsibility to implement robust encryption and secure storage practices, but the current landscape is often patchy, leaving user files vulnerable to breaches or misuse. Users should explore alternative, more privacy-focused apps whenever possible and remain vigilant about how their personal data is being utilized by these increasingly sophisticated tools.
